Paubox

Paubox is a HIPAA-compliant email encryption platform purpose-built for healthcare organizations. It encrypts every outbound email by default using TLS with automatic fallback to a secure portal, so recipients read messages in their normal inbox without passwords or portals. Paubox is HITRUST CSF certified and signs BAAs, making it the go-to choice for hospitals, health systems, and medical practices that need frictionless HIPAA-compliant email.

Pros
  • No portal login required for recipients
  • HITRUST CSF certified — highest bar for healthcare
  • Zero learning curve for senders
  • Purpose-built for healthcare compliance
  • Includes inbound email security
Cons
  • Premium pricing for smaller practices
  • Less granular sender control than end-to-end solutions
  • Healthcare focus may not fit all industries
  • No on-premise deployment option

Pricing: From $29/user/month

Echoworx

Echoworx is an enterprise email encryption platform that supports seven different encryption methods to match any recipient's capability — from TLS and portal to PGP, S/MIME, and PDF encryption. Designed for large organizations in regulated industries, Echoworx provides policy-driven automation, brandable secure portals, and integrations with Microsoft 365, Google Workspace, and on-premise mail servers. Echoworx signs BAAs for HIPAA-covered entities.

Pros
  • Most flexible delivery options in the market
  • Brandable portals improve recipient experience
  • Proven enterprise scalability
  • Strong compliance posture across frameworks
  • Works with any email platform
Cons
  • Enterprise pricing may be too expensive for SMBs
  • Complexity can increase deployment time
  • Smaller market presence than Zix or Virtru
  • Custom pricing requires sales engagement

Pricing: Custom enterprise pricing
